web-dev-qa-db-fra.com

Xcode 9 - Utilisation élevée du processeur - Vitesse maximale du ventilateur

Depuis que je suis passé à Xcode 9, mon fan devient fou quand je travaille sur Xcode. Cela se produit surtout lorsque j'utilise des story-boards et Interface Builder.

Xcode prend parfois jusqu'à 100% du CPU et le processus nommé "Interface Builder Cocoa Touch Tool" est également très gourmand.

J'ai lu ici et là que d'autres personnes ont eu des problèmes similaires, mais je me demandais si quelqu'un avait trouvé une solution à cela étant donné qu'il s'agit très probablement d'un bogue Xcode.

Ce que j'ai essayé:

  • Débrancher mon deuxième écran: aucun effet
  • Redémarrer Xcode: aucun effet
  • Redémarrer Mac: aucun effet
  • Nettoyage du dossier des données dérivées: aucun effet
  • Projet de nettoyage: aucun effet
  • Ouverture d'un seul projet à l'époque (ennuyeux): un peu mieux mais toujours pas génial

Quelqu'un at-il trouvé une solution à ce problème?

Mac Config:

  • MacBook Pro (Retina, 15 pouces, mi-2014)
  • Processeur: Intel Core i7 2,5 GHz
  • Mémoire: 16 Go 1600 MHz DDR3
  • Graphiques: NVIDIA GeForce GT 750M 2048 Mo Intel Iris Pro 1536 Mo

version Xcode: 9.0 (9A235)

22
Edouard Barbier

Ouvrez vos xibs/storyboards et désactivez "Editeur/Actualiser automatiquement les vues".

Le problème est dû au fait que Xcode reconstruit continuellement votre projet pour mettre à jour des éléments tels que _ IB_DESIGNABLE vues.

Déclenchez-le manuellement via Editor > Refresh All views

8
Tamás Zahola